Certified Apartment Maintenance Technician Designation Course

Earn your Certificate for Apartment Maintenance Technicians and advance your career in apartment maintenance. NAAEI developed the CAMT program to provide the knowledge and tools necessary to run a cost-effective maintenance program. Whether you are a new or experienced maintenance technician, you can improve your:
• Management of Preventive Maintenance
• Accuracy of Diagnosis of Maintenance Issues
• Ability to Make Cost-Effective Repair/Replacement Decisions

To obtain the CAMT credential, candidates must complete the following:
- Minimum of 12 months of apartment or rental housing maintenance experience.
- If the candidate has not met this experience requirement before enrolling in the program, they will be eligible to earn the Provisional CAMT.
- Once the Provisional CAMT is earned, the credential holder has two years from the date the Provisional CAMT was earned to meet the twelve-months experience requirement and upgrade to the full CAMT credential. If the credential holder fails to submit the application in PACE and meet all requirements to upgrade to the full CAMT within the two-year window, they will be required to take the course and pass the exam again. The Provisional CAMT will expire after two years.
- To upgrade from the Provisional CAMT to the full CAMT, follow these instructions.
- Successful completion of all CAMT classroom and online coursework.
- Pass the examination.
